Description

Crux at the roof on second pitch. Really great climbing on good rock. Big runout on easier terrain keeps people off this classic. Cruxes are protected well.

Location

Same start as driller instinct and traverses hard right. Not to be confused with the 10c unknown that branches off slightly left

Protection

Some slings for horns on the runout would make it safer. Maybe even some tricams in the pockets?
